Meet Gather Collect

A gorgeously curated haven of beautiful objects at the fun and quirky Aranda shops. Many of the things they sell are made in Canberra, but those that aren’t are still made by small Australian artisans and creatives. They have clothing, shoes, jewellery, homewares, baby goods, cards and wrap, wall art, furniture, candles and much more. You can buy gifts from as little as $20. And they have vouchers available too. The store is run by a gorgeous couple, who have just had their first baby, and they are super passionate about what they do. It makes me feel good every time I visit their store!

Bison

One year I did about 60% of my Christmas shopping at Bison. Last year, we bought a few gifts there too, and we also spent Christmas money that we were gifted there on ourselves!!! If you don’t know this brand, you need to. Brian’s creations are the ultimate in luxurious, heirloom homewares. They have beautiful high end objects like vases and platters that nobody ever buys for themselves (hello, perfect gift!). But they also have a lot of regular items like glasses, dinnerware, teapots, coffee cups, all made with amazing attention to detail and in beautiful seasonal colours. We love our Bison items! I couldn’t recommend this brand more highly.

The Canberra Distillery gin and vodka

This small batch distillery has been super visible at all local foodie events in recent years. Our very favourite of all they do is the French Earl Grey Gin. It’s a beautiful deep purple colour, but when you mix it, it turns pink. It’s super fun to drink, and tastes amazing. Such a great gift for a gin lover, or someone who doesn’t need ‘things’.

Contentious Character wines

I love these wines as a gift because their labels are so fun and provide scope to really personalise your gift! Labels include ‘Dry as a dead dingoes donga’ and ‘It takes time to reach your prime’. Most bottles are around the $30-$40 mark and they also sell a range of their own condiments, plus gift cards and food/wine experiences.
